Iowa States stunning comeback against Kentucky in the NCAA Tournament showcased their grit and composure. Despite trailing by twelve early, seniors Tamin Lipsey and Nate Heise kept the team steady, leading an eight-to-zero run into halftime. The Cyclones outscored Kentucky fifty-one to thirty-three in the second half, forcing twenty turnovers and securing a dominant victory. This performance proves Iowa States ability to overcome challenges when they execute.
